The Lexus LX and LM registered a 50 per cent year-on-year growth and contributed around 19 per cent to the brand’s overall sales in CY2025.
Lexus India concluded the 2025 calendar year on a high with strong demand for the LM and LX flagship models. The automaker announced both the Lexus LM and LX recorded a 50 per cent increase in demand year-on-year, contributing a healthy 19 per cent to overall sales in CY2025.
The Lexus RX was a major growth driver recording an 18 per cent growth in sales year-on-year, and a 22 per cent contribution to overall sales. The locally assembled Lexus ES 300h continues to be the automaker’s highest-selling model in the country. The automaker has not shared sales numbers for the previous year.

Speaking about the sales performance, Hikaru Ikeuchi - President, Lexus India, said, “We are immensely thankful to our guests for their trust and support throughout 2025. The strong performance of our halo ultra-luxury models, LX and LM, reflects their confidence in Lexus and our dedication to delivering exceptional products and experiences that continue to push boundaries. As we move into 2026, we are encouraged by the outlook for luxury vehicles in India and will remain focused on delivering even more exciting offerings and memorable experiences.”
The Lexus LM 350h sits at the top of luxury panel vans sold in the country, which has caught the attention of high net-worth individuals with its spacious and luxurious interiors, and a distinctive design. It does not have a direct rival in the segment, giving the model absolute dominance.
On the other hand, the Lexus LX 500d SUV is the brand’s flagship offering and remains a capable off-road SUV, exuding power, presence, and stature in a compelling package. Notably, the LX is the only diesel offering in Lexus India’s lineup, which is otherwise powered by petrol-hybrid engines. The LX takes on the Mercedes-Benz G-Wagen, Land Rover Range Rover, Audi RS Q8, and more.
